![]() Yeah, you don't wanna be like me because you'll end up with a horribly ugly car. ![]() The GT-Four vent in the center was coming along fine, but trying to mold '98-'01 Integra turn signals into the bumper didn't go so well. After cutting out the holes for the turn signals and drilling a couple hundred small holes(good thing the pic is so small so you can't see them. ![]() I then realized that the Integra clear corners are far too wide...the back of the turn signal housing hits the aluminum crash-reinforcement bar. I took the bar off temporarily just to see how it could've looked with the turn signals, and the back of the housings still hit the frame where the reinforcement bar bolts to. So now I'm temporarily driving around with two large cutouts surrounded by hundreds of tiny holes, and a bit cutout in the center with some fiberglass hanging back from it. Then the turn signal bulbs are zip-tied through a couple of the holes I drilled to hold them in place. It looks really bad, and probably will for a while until I can get a stock front bumper painted and put on there. Oh well, at least its a lesson to always measure before you start cutting and drilling...I didn't even think about the fact that the turn signals might hit the frame. -------------------- New Toyota project coming soon...
